The Ithaca College men’s soccer team edged out the King’s College Monarchs Sept. 13 in a heated 1-0 contest. The matchup saw five yellow cards and plenty of physicality from start to finish. The Bombers have now won five consecutive games to open their season, a feat that has not been achieved by the program since 2007.

The Ithaca College football team could not muster a revenge game as the No. 3 Johns Hopkins University Blue Jays defeated the Bombers for the third straight season, with a final score of 42-14 on Sept. 6 at Butterfield Stadium.

The Ithaca College men’s soccer team captured its second consecutive win of the season Sept. 3, improving its record on the season to 2-0-0. The South Hill crowd was treated to three goals, two of them coming from the penalty spot. IC’s 3-0 win over the Elmira College Soaring Eagles marked another clean sheet for the young squad, a team with Liberty League Championship title aspirations.

Every year, the Ithaca College Office of Intercollegiate Athletics hosts a “Be the Match” bone marrow drive to recruit potential blood stem cell donors. This year, the Sept. 19 drive took on an added significance, showing support for Jack Dembow ’77, a member of the Ithaca College Board of Trustees, who is in need of a bone marrow transplant.

Ithaca College Athletics announced the return of the Blue Crew student rewards program on Jan. 31. This program brings together Ithaca College students, giving them an incentive to attend sporting events in return for points toward special prizes.
